Assessing Your Power Demands and Usage



How do you establish your power needs prior to installing a planetary system? Beginning by examining your past electrical power bills.

Seek your month-to-month use in kilowatt-hours (kWh) over the in 2015; this'll give you a strong standard. Next off, think about any kind of adjustments you prepare to make, like adding brand-new appliances or an electrical car, as these will affect your future power requirements.

You ought to also examine the effectiveness of your home-- poor insulation or old appliances can raise energy consumption.



Lastly, think of your way of living behaviors; for instance, if you're typically home throughout the day, you may require a larger system to cover daytime usage.

Recognizing Various Sorts Of Solar Systems



After examining your power requires, it is essential to check out the different sorts of planetary systems offered.

Grid-tied systems link directly to the utility grid, allowing you to offer excess energy back. They're typically one of the most cost-efficient option if you have reliable grid gain access to.

Assessing Costs, Motivations, and Funding Options



When considering a planetary system, have you thought about the expenses, incentives, and financing choices offered to you?

Initially, review the overall costs, consisting of installment, equipment, and maintenance. Compare quotes from various suppliers to guarantee you're obtaining a reasonable deal.

Next off, consider government and state incentives that can significantly decrease your upfront financial investment. Tax obligation debts, refunds, and performance-based incentives can aid you conserve.

Last but not least, check out financing alternatives like solar car loans, leases, or power purchase contracts (PPAs). Each choice has its benefits and drawbacks, so choose one that fits your budget and energy demands.
